Third-party Software Versions

The following third-party software versions are included in this release and provide 64-bit compatibility or security enhancements:

3rd-party Software Version
Apache HTTP Server 2.4.58
Apache Tomcat 9.0.87
JRE (Zulu built on OpenJDK) 1.8.0_402 (Zulu 8.72.0.17)/17.0.8.1 (Zulu 17.44.53)
MySQL Server 8.0.36(VS)/5.7.42 (VRS)
ODBC Connector Not installed; used at install-time only
TLS 1.3 and 1.2
PJSIP 2.14

Installation

Follow these instructions to install Vocera Voice Server or upgrade it to the latest version. .

Installation prerequisites

To install or upgrade:

Note: While installing or uninstalling, you can be repeatedly presented with pop-up messages instructing you to reboot for changes to be applied. Do not reboot when prompted. Wait until the installation is complete to reboot.
  1. To perform a new installation, follow the steps described in the Running theVocera Voice Server Installation Program section of the Vocera Voice Server Installation Guide.
  2. To upgrade from previous Vocera versions, follow the steps described in Upgrading Vocera Voice Server to Version 5.6.0 section of the Vocera Voice Server Installation Guide.
    Note: Your previous system configuration remains in the database that is restored at the end of the upgrade. Because some 4.x features have been deprecated.
    • Update the values in your database as follows:
      1. Open the Vocera Voice Server Administration Console and navigate to the System > Preferences page.
      2. Choose Save Changes.

        The server updates your database and removes any settings for deprecated features.

    • Convert custom names directory:
      • If you are upgrading from a version 4.x deployment and have a custom names dictionary, convert the custom names directory to the version 5.x format manually.
      • If you are upgrading from version 5.x and have a custom names dictionary, no conversion is required.

Fixed Issues

The following list contains fixes and improvements made to the Vocera Voice Server 5.10.x platform.

Fixed Issues in Version 5.10.2.66

The following list includes items fixed or improved in this version of the Vocera Voice Server.

  • VCXP-18613 When a user sends a text message to another user with the “Send a text message” command from a Smartbadge connected to VMP, the text message is not delivered.
  • VCXP-18448 When the French-Canadian localization pack is installed on the Voice Server, the server logs cannot be read by Vocera Analytics due to a log format error.
  • VCXP-18197 When the French-Canadian localization pack is installed on the Voice Server, the emergency broadcast location message is displayed in English instead of French.
  • VCXP-18170 Genie audio can unexpectedly use ports outside the documented port range of 7500-8220.
  • VCXP-18147 For customers with Enhanced Voice enabled, saying the command “Transfer to 1234” without specifying “extension” results in no response from the Genie.
  • VCXP-18144 For customers with enhanced voice enabled, the Genie does not provide the site name when disambiguating multiple users with the same name in both the current site and the global site.
  • VCXP-18129 For customers with enhanced voice enabled for guest access calls, the Genie does not search the configured shared sites.
  • VCXP-18110 For customers with enhanced voice enabled for yes/no interactions, the Badge button responses are not processed, requiring the user to verbally say "yes" or "no."
  • VCXP-18109 For customers with enhanced voice enabled, the “Add me to multiple groups” command does not correctly process confirmation responses when multiple groups are offered in the response.
  • CRVC-27152 In certain scenarios involving momentary network disruption, the signaling gateway service can stop listening for connections. This results in Smartbadges being in a "Searching for Server" state and requires a voice cluster failover to resolve.
  • CRVC-27146 A rare race condition involving a user receiving a conference call and a separate one-to-one call at approximately the same time can cause the Voice Server cluster to failover.
  • CRVC-27044 Modifying and saving a group with more than 1000 members can cause some group membership or permission information to be lost.
  • CRVC-27040 For customers with the VST connector configured, updates to call log information can make the VST connector to disconnect from the Voice Server requiring a manual refresh to resolve.
  • CRVC-27040 In certain rare cases, special characters such as emoji’s can end being stored on the Voice Server causing the backup file to be invalid.

Known Issues

A few issues are known to exist in the Vocera Voice Server 5.10.x platform and this section summarizes all the known issues in the release.

Known Issues in the Vocera Voice Server

This section summarizes known product defects and limitations, including any workarounds we may have, for the Vocera Voice Server 5.10.x platform.

  • CRVC-24212 Entering an invalid IP address in the “Report Server IP Address” field in the VS Admin Console can cause the Voice Server to crash.

    Workaround: Fix the invalid IP address in the “Report Server IP Address” field.

  • CRVC-27846 Voice Server no longer sends alert messages, voice email messages, and email messages to the Vocera devices when the mail server authentication is configured to use Microsoft Graph.
